Life expectancy for children diagnosed with Edwards syndrome is short due to several life-threatening complications of the condition. Trisomy 18 also called Edwards syndrome is a chromosomal condition associated with abnormalities in many parts of the body.

Studies show that 60 to 75 of children survive for 24 hours 20 to 60 for 1 week 22 to 44 for 1 month 9 to 18 for 6 months and 5 to 10 for over 1 year. Half of all babies born with Edwards syndrome die within the first week and only 5 to 10 live beyond the first year of life. Edwards syndrome trisomy 18 was first described by John Hilton Edwards 1928 2007 a British medical geneticist. Edwards syndrome also known as trisomy 18 is a genetic disorder caused by the presence of a third copy of all or part of chromosome 18.

The life expectancy of a baby born with Edwards syndrome is between 3 days and 2 weeks. Other features include a small head small jaw clenched fists with overlapping fingers and severe intellectual disability.
